### CI tests
In order to test that each module added to `nf-core/modules` is actually working and to be able to track any changes to results files between module updates we have set-up a number of Github Actions CI tests to run each module on a minimal test dataset using Docker, Singularity and Conda.
#### Test data
- All test data for `nf-core/modules` MUST be added to [`tests/data/`](tests/data/) and organised by filename extension.
- In order to keep the size of this repository as minimal as possible, pre-existing files from [`tests/data/`](tests/data/) MUST be reused if at all possible.
- Test files MUST be kept as tiny as possible.
#### Pytest workflow
- Every module MUST have a test workflow utilising test data added to the appropriate directory e.g. [`tests/software/fastqc/main.nf`](tests/software/fastqc/main.nf)
- Any outputs produced by the test workflow MUST be included in the [pytest-workflow](https://pytest-workflow.readthedocs.io/en/stable) for that tool e.g. [`tests/software/fastqc/test.yml`](tests/software/fastqc/test.yml). `md5sum` checks are the preferable choice of test to determine file changes, however, this may not be possible for all outputs generated by some tools e.g. if they include time stamps or command-related headers. Please do your best to avoid just checking for the file being present e.g. it may still be possible to check that the file contains the appropriate text snippets.

### Uploading to `nf-core/modules`
[Fork](https://help.github.com/articles/fork-a-repo/) the `nf-core/modules` repository to your own GitHub account. Within the local clone of your fork add the module file to the [`software/`](software) directory.
[Fork](https://help.github.com/articles/fork-a-repo/) the `nf-core/modules` repository to your own GitHub account. Within the local clone of your fork add the module file to the [`software/`](software) directory. Please try and keep PRs as atomic as possible to aid the reviewing process - ideally, one module addition/update per PR.
Commit and push these changes to your local clone on GitHub, and then [create a pull request](https://help.github.com/articles/creating-a-pull-request-from-a-fork/) on the `nf-core/modules` GitHub repo with the appropriate information.
